Description
The PXIe-7858R, also referred to by its part numbers PXIe-7858R and 784147-01, is a high-performance module categorized under the PXI R Series. This model, the PXIe-7858, is powered by the Kintex-7 325T FPGA, offering robust processing capabilities. It comes with 512 MB of DRAM, ensuring efficient data handling and storage.
For interfacing, the module provides 8 analog input/output channels and 48 digital input/output channels, supporting a wide range of signals. The analog channels can operate at a sample rate of 1 MS/s, making it suitable for high-speed data acquisition and control tasks. Input modes available include DIFF, NRSE, RSE, which are software-selectable, providing flexibility in signal measurement. The input signal range is quite versatile, accommodating ±1 V, ±2 V, ±5 V, ±10 V, allowing the module to work with a variety of sensors and signal types.
Its design includes features for protecting the device and connected equipment. The analog inputs have a bias and offset current of ±5 nA and offer overvoltage protection of ±42 V maximum when powered on, and ±35 V maximum when powered off. For outputs, the range is ±10 V with DC coupling, and protection includes short circuit to ground, ±15 V overvoltage when powered on, and ±10 V overvoltage when powered off.
Users can configure the power-on state for all analog and digital I/Os, allowing for customized setup based on application requirements. The module also boasts a slew rate of 10 V/µs and a glitch energy of ±10 mV for 3 µs at midscale transition, indicating its ability to handle rapid signal changes smoothly
